Pentax RS1500 vs Sony NEX-5 Overview

Below is a extensive analysis of the Pentax RS1500 versus Sony NEX-5, one being a Small Sensor Compact and the latter is a Entry-Level Mirrorless by competitors Pentax and Sony. The resolution of the RS1500 (14MP) and the NEX-5 (14MP) is pretty well matched but the RS1500 (1/2.3") and NEX-5 (APS-C) feature different sensor size.

Pentax RS1500 vs Sony NEX-5 Physical Comparison

For anybody who is intending to lug around your camera often, you will need to consider its weight and volume. The Pentax RS1500 enjoys outer measurements of 114mm x 58mm x 28mm (4.5" x 2.3" x 1.1") and a weight of 157 grams (0.35 lbs) while the Sony NEX-5 has sizing of 111mm x 59mm x 38mm (4.4" x 2.3" x 1.5") having a weight of 287 grams (0.63 lbs).

Pentax RS1500 vs Sony NEX-5 Sensor Comparison

Often, it is difficult to imagine the gap between sensor measurements just by checking technical specs. The graphic below may provide you a better sense of the sensor measurements in the RS1500 and NEX-5.

As you have seen, the two cameras posses the exact same resolution albeit different sensor measurements. The RS1500 offers the tinier sensor which is going to make getting shallow DOF more challenging. The more modern RS1500 should have a benefit in sensor technology.
